Kingfisher superintendent/Hall of Fame Coach dies at 65
0
KINGFISHER, Okla. (KFOR) - Kingfisher Superintendent David Glover died at age 65.
According to the Kingfisher Times & Free Press Glover had been dealing with several health complications and had been hospitalized multiple times in recent weeks.
Glover was inducted into the Oklahoma Coaches Hall of Fame in 2021 and had been a superintendent at Newkirk, Bethel, and Okarche. He coached basketball for many years.
He came to Kingfisher Public Schools in 2022 when he was promoted to succeed Dr. Daniel Craig.
Okarche Public Schools posted on Facebook, "Okarche Public Schools sends our condolences and are praying for Mr. David Glover’s family and Kingfisher Public Schools."
